most-searched-technical-colleges-in-montana Colleges Student Population Comparison

For the academic year 2022-2023, the total student population of most-searched-technical-colleges-in-montana Colleges is 4,995.
The proportion of undergraduate students is 95.54% (4,772 students) and graduate students's proportion is 4.46% (223 graduate students).
Montana Technological University has the most students of 1,625 among most-searched-technical-colleges-in-montana Colleges. By gender, the male-female ratio at most-searched-technical-colleges-in-montana Colleges is 45.97% (2,296 male students) to 54.03% (2,699 female students).
